If you use a script-driven app for your site, any data which both you and the site users create will be stored within a database - a collection of info, that is arranged in cells and tables for simpler reading and writing. The latter is carried out by employing special software called database management system and one of the most well-known ones around the globe is MySQL. A number of script apps are built to work with MySQL because it’s simple to use, it works perfectly on a web server and it's also universal as it can work with well-known web programming languages (PHP, Perl, Python, Java) and on a variety of web server OS (Windows, UNIX, Linux). There are loads of scripts that use MySQL, including quite popular ones for example WordPress, Moodle and Joomla.
